What the data says
Among 142 Real Estate companies, Ventas is in the top 6% for shareholders' equity. Shareholders' Equity has fluctuated over the past 10 years, ranging from $9.5B in FY2023 to $12.5B in FY2025.
Based on SEC 10-K filings.
$12.5B in FY2025 with a 5-year CAGR of +4.2%. Top quartile in the Real Estate sector.
Improved from $9.5B to $12.5B over the past 2 years.

Annual data
| Year | Shareholders' EquityValue | YoY GrowthYoY |
|---|---|---|
| FY2025 | $12.5B | +16.3% |
| FY2024 | $10.8B | +13.5% |
| FY2023 | $9.5B | -6.5% |
| FY2022 | $10.2B | -6.5% |
| FY2021 | $10.9B | +6.6% |
| FY2020 | $10.2B | -2.5% |
| FY2019 | $10.4B | +2.3% |
| FY2018 | $10.2B | -6.0% |
| FY2017 | $10.9B | +3.9% |
| FY2016 | $10.5B | +9.4% |
